Well, let's not waste more time in same moot arguments. What I
want to add is this: Microsoft is now aiming at providing the
ultimate managerial tools (yes, they are marketing geniuses),
i.e.: dashboards and scorecards.
They work with elements of Office (and other parts to be purchased
separately), would anyone tell me whether there may be equivalent
tools obtainable on the free market, i.e.: Open Office, open
source or otherwise?
This is the business intelligence tools that Microsoft are coming out
with now. There are equivalent tools within the open source community
including Pentaho and Jasper Intelligence. Both of these are Java
based and in theory could be integrated into OpenOffice.org in some
way, but I don't think this is the right way. Looking at messaging
and web services would be a much better way of integrating these
larger project capabilities (as well as others) into OpenOffice.org.
One little project that is worth looking at is Palo. It is looking at
building an OpenOffice.org interface for their product, so I
recommend people go and have a look at what they are doing.
